Background
Lin Mo is the daughter of Lin Wucheng, the Lin Family head, and the niece of Steward Lin. Her family raised her around swordsmanship, viewing her talent as greater than that of her two elder brothers and hoping she could become a “female sword god.” 99 103
Before meeting Zhu Ping’an, Lin Mo believed her life contained little beyond cultivating the sword. She later reflects that their meeting showed her there were interesting things in life outside swordsmanship. 193

Personality
Lin Mo is exceptionally earnest about swordsmanship. She values a worthy opponent above social convention, immediately becoming attached to Zhu Ping’an because he can match her technique for technique. Her enthusiasm is direct and childlike: after their first prolonged spar, she tells him she likes him because he is a good opponent. 98 99
Her innocence leaves her vulnerable to Zhu Ping’an’s deception; she sincerely mistakes explicit videos for advanced swordsmanship materials and studies them all night in pursuit of insight. Even after learning she was deceived, she refuses to identify Zhu Ping’an to her family because she promised not to reveal his name. 100 102 104
Lin Mo becomes increasingly decisive and protective. She defends Zhu Ping’an from Steward Lin and Lin Wucheng, confronts Cui Yi to aid Che Shiman, and later speaks openly against Xue Changli’s contempt for Zhu Ping’an. 99 117 136 177

Story Role
Swordsmanship Sparring Partner
Lin Mo meets Zhu Ping’an when he accepts a mission to become her sparring partner. Their skills and cultivation are evenly matched, making each of them the other’s ideal opponent. She insists that he remain at the Lin residence so they can practice every morning. 98 99
The “Swordsmanship Manuals” Deception
Zhu Ping’an deceives Lin Mo into believing explicit videos are ancestral swordsmanship manuals containing the insights of foreign masters. Her determination to improve leads her to study thousands of recordings and take notes, until her family realizes she has been misled. 100 102 103 104
Lin Mo later attacks Zhu Ping’an after learning the truth, but he convinces her that the materials were intended to teach the union of opposing powers through his Immortal Devil Sword Technique. She apologizes and resumes cooperating with him. 115 116
Cangqiong Ancient Saint Inheritance
Lin Wucheng sends Lin Mo to Cangqiong Academy alongside Zhu Ping’an to compete for the Cangqiong Ancient Saint’s inheritance. During the competition, she distracts Cui Yi by joining Che Shiman’s side, enabling Zhu Ping’an to refine the Golden Cicada Spirit Blood. 106 117
She later secures a Stone Platform with the Kill Word Sword Technique. The technique’s presence causes Lin Wucheng to incorrectly conclude that she was the one who obtained the ancient saint’s legacy. 119 132
Four Fiends Mystic Realm Trial
After returning a year later as an early Third Tier martial artist, Lin Mo joins Cangqiong Academy’s trial team. Zhu Ping’an arranges for her ancient sword to be reforged and gives her dragon-hide protective equipment before the trial. 168 170 172 174
Within the Four Fiends Mystic Realm, Lin Mo fights alongside her team against foreign martial artists, supports Zhu Ping’an against Ruomu Jian, and is rescued by Zhu Ping’an after being trapped by Ruomu Jian’s spell. She later suffers critical injuries while using a desperate sword-based sacrifice technique and is saved alongside Leng Tianjiao. 189 193 195 196
